Form DMV-DS-23P, Application for a Driver's License or Identification Card, or the West Virginia Driver's License Application Form is a form used by new residents, alien citizens, and first-time drivers to apply for a state identification card or driver's license in West Virginia.
Enter all applicable information on your West Virginia Driver's License Application Form. If incomplete, your application will not be processed.

Has your address changed since your last License/ID issuance?
Mark Yes if your address has changed since your last license or identification issuance. Then, enter your previous address. If not, mark No.
Are you a U.S. Citizen? If not, list your Alien Registration Number below.
Mark Yes, if you are a U.S. citizen. If not, mark No. Then, enter your Alien Registration Number.
Have you been issued a license/ID in another jurisdiction in the last 10 years?
Mark Yes, if you have been issued a license or ID in another jurisdiction in the last ten years. Then, enter the jurisdiction and the license or ID number. If not, mark No.
Do you have a suspended/revoked license or a pending license suspension/revocation in ANY jurisdiction within the previous five years?
Mark Yes, if you have a suspended or revoked license or a pending license suspension or revocation in any jurisdiction within the previous five years. Then, provide a letter of explanation of the incident, including its date. If not, mark No.
Have you been refused a license by any jurisdiction within the previous five years?
Mark Yes, if you have been refused a license by any jurisdiction within the previous five years. Then, provide a letter of explanation of the incident, including its date. If not, mark No.
APPLICANTS THAT OWE A CHILD SUPPORT OBLIGATION ONLY: Do you owe an obligation that is more than six months in arrears?
Complete this item if you are an applicant who owes a child support obligation.
Mark Yes, if you owe an obligation that is more than six months in arrears. If not, mark No.
APPLICANTS THAT OWE A CHILD SUPPORT OBLIGATION ONLY: Are you the subject of a child support-related warrant, subpoena, or court order?
Complete this item if you are an applicant who owes a child support obligation.
Mark Yes, if you are a subject of child support-related warrant, subpoena, or court order. If not, mark No.
LEVEL 2 GDL Applicants ONLY: Have you been convicted of a traffic violation in the past six months?
Complete this item if you are a level two graduated driver's license applicant.
Mark Yes, if you have been convicted of a traffic violation in the past six months. If not, mark No.
LEVEL 3 GDL Applicants ONLY: Have you been convicted of a traffic violation in the past 12 months?
Complete this item if you are a level three graduated driver's license applicant.
Mark Yes, if you have been convicted of a traffic violation in the past 12 months. If not, mark No.
Do you have any visual/medical condition(s) affecting your ability to drive safely?
Mark Yes if you have any visual or medical conditions affecting your ability to drive safely. Then, provide a letter of explanation. If not, mark No.
Do you wish to be designated on your license as an organ donor?
Mark Yes, if you wish to be designated on your license as an organ donor. If not, mark No.
Do you wish to be designated on your license as diabetic?
Mark Yes if you wish to be designated on your license as diabetic. Then, let a licensed physician certify your condition and complete the Medical Endorsement section on your West Virginia Driver's License Application Form. If not, mark No.
Do you wish to be designated on your license as hearing impaired?
Mark Yes if you wish to be designated on your license as hearing impaired. Then, let a licensed audiologist certify your condition and complete the Medical Endorsement section on your West Virginia Driver's License Application Form. If not, mark No.
Veterans of the United States Military ONLY: Do you wish to have the United States Veterans designation on your license?
Complete this item if you are a veteran of the United States military.
Mark Yes, if you wish to have the United States Veterans designation on your license. If not, mark No.
If you marked Yes, the Department of Motor Vehicles must verify your status with your Form DD 214, Discharge Papers and Separation Documents, Form WD AGO 53, Enlisted Record and Report of Separation Honorable Discharge, Form WD AGO 55, Honorable Discharge from The Army of the United States, Form WD AGO 53-55, Enlisted Record and Report of Separation Honorable Discharge, Form NAVPERS-553, Notice of Separation from U.S. Naval Service, Form NAVMC 78PD, U.S. Marine Corps Report of Separation NAVCG 553, Military Identification Card, or Current Military license plate registration card.
Have you ever experienced seizures or loss of consciousness, emotional or mental illness, alcohol or drug problems, or any physical condition that requires you to use special equipment to drive?
Mark Yes, if you have experienced seizures or loss of consciousness, emotional or mental illness, alcohol or drug problems, or any physical condition that requires you to use special equipment to drive. Then, provide a letter of explanation. If not, mark No.
Ages 18 and up ONLY: Do you wish to register to vote?
Complete this item if you are age 18 or older.
Mark Yes if you wish to register to vote. If no, mark No.
Do you wish to make a contribution to the West Virginia State Police Forensic Laboratory Fund?
Mark Yes if you wish to make a contribution to the West Virginia State Police Forensic Laboratory Fund. Then, enter the amount. If not, mark No.
Do you wish to make a contribution to the West Virginia Department of Veterans Assistance?
Mark Yes, if you wish to make a contribution to the West Virginia Department of Veterans Assistance. Then, mark the amount. You may choose $3, $5, or $10.
If not, mark No.

A Graduated Driver's License (GDL) is a temporary license for teen drivers. It has a three-level approach to grant young or teen drivers full license privileges.
GDL consists of three levels — one, two, and three.
Level 1. Level 1 GDL is a supervised learner's license issued to young drivers at least 14 years and nine months old.

Level 2. Level 2 GDL is an intermediate license that limits unsupervised nighttime driving for teen drivers at least 16 years old.

Level 3. Level 3 GDL is a full-privilege driver license automatically issued to teen drivers at least 17 years if they completed Level 1 and 2 GDLs.
